Bernhard H. C. Sputh is a scholar working on Hardware and Architecture, Artificial Intelligence and Computational Theory and Mathematics. According to data from OpenAlex, Bernhard H. C. Sputh has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 266 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Hardware and Architecture, 7 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 7 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ics. Recurrent topics in Bernhard H. C. Sputh's work include Embedded Systems Design Techniques (10 papers), Real-Time Systems Scheduling (5 papers) and Distributed systems and fault tolerance (4 papers). Bernhard H. C. Sputh is often cited by papers focused on Embedded Systems Design Techniques (10 papers), Real-Time Systems Scheduling (5 papers) and Distributed systems and fault tolerance (4 papers). Bernhard H. C. Sputh coll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Singapore and Belgium. Bernhard H. C. Sputh's co-authors include Oliver Faust, U. Rajendra Acharya, Lim Choo Min, Alastair Robert Allen, Neil C. C. Brown, Peter H. Welch, Kevin Chalmers, Vitaliy Mezhuyev, Jianguo Ma and Raymond Boute and has published in prestigious journals such as Computer Methods and Programs in Biomedicine, IEEE Transactions on Consumer Electronics and International Journal of Neural Systems.
